Output 59437ef6b3b0c29899341cf6e1eb149eae3bd7ecc28960fdbe778bbff45b8f7b:3

value
1069550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1106c38080725594079abb7607b97b524adc48ed OP_EQUAL
address
33F3WkfEwZhrMbdJXTEJyF8cFcKJd1K8bV
transaction
59437ef6b3b0c29899341cf6e1eb149eae3bd7ecc28960fdbe778bbff45b8f7b